Marcos Barcellos Café is a scholar working on Animal Science and Zoology, Aquatic Science and Plant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Marcos Barcellos Café has authored 119 papers receiving a total of 761 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 104 papers in Animal Science and Zoology, 41 papers in Aquatic Science and 19 papers in Plant Science. Recurrent topics in Marcos Barcellos Café’s work include Animal Nutrition and Physiology (104 papers), Aquaculture Nutrition and Growth (41 papers) and Livestock and Poultry Management (36 papers). Marcos Barcellos Café is often cited by papers focused on Animal Nutrition and Physiology (104 papers), Aquaculture Nutrition and Growth (41 papers) and Livestock and Poultry Management (36 papers). Marcos Barcellos Café collaborates with scholars based in Brazil, United States and Sweden. Marcos Barcellos Café's co-authors include José Henrique Stringhini, Nadja Susana Mogyca Leandro, María Auxiliadora Andrade, C.A. Fritts, A.B. Batal, Nick Dale, P.W. Waldroup, Fabyola Barros de Carvalho, Itallo Conrado Sousa Araújo and Adriana Ayres Pedroso and has published in prestigious journals such as Animal Feed Science and Technology, Animal Reproduction Science and Aquaculture Nutrition.
